user
Tura Guest House
5 Ganiyu Bello St, 200263, Ibadan, Nigeria
Appearance
Tura Guest House

Comments
Jo
Review №1

Not cool

Ba
Review №2

Cool inn

Mo
Review №3

Affordable

ch
Review №4

Just there

Information
1 Photos
4 Comments
2 Rating
  • Address:5 Ganiyu Bello St, 200263, Ibadan, Nigeria
Categories
  • Guest house
Similar organizations